Abstract

1324340 Clocks and watches OMEGA LOUIS BRANDT & FRERE S A 27 Oct 1970 [13 Nov 1969] 50936/70 Heading G3T An arrangement for obtaining a rotary drive for a timepiece from an oscillating body 7, Fig. 1, comprises a ratchet wheel 9 and pawls 10, 11 all of which are carried by the body 7, the ratchet wheel being movably mounted relatively to the pawls so that it is stepped around thereby when the body 7 changes its direction. The ratchet wheel 9 is coupled magnetically to a wheel 12 which is part of the timepiece train and has a fixed axis of rotation 13. The body 7 is carried by a vibratory arm 6 and includes a magnetized hole shoe 1. Vibrations are maintained by co-operation with a fixed coil 2 which is mounted on a core 3 having an electric oscillator circuit in its interior. A similar pole shoe 1 may be carried by a second vibratory arm 6 in a symmetrical arrangement. Preferably the body 7 carries an hermetically sealed sleeve 37, Fig. 4, on the base 36 of which are mounted a ratchet wheel 33 and pawls 31, 32. The sleeve 37 may be filled with a gas or liquid such as silicone oil. The position of pawl 31 may be adjusted by rotating an eccentric screw 41 to deflect resilient arm 34. An alternative method is shown in the case of the pawl 32 which is carried by a frictionally mounted arm 35. The ratchet wheel 33 has a hub portion 46 which is magnetized to co-operate with a wheel positioned outside the sleeve 37. The hub portion 46 contains a hole which is larger than the diameter of a retaining pin (48), Fig. 5 (not shown) to permit the necessary movement of the wheel 33. The ratchet wheel may alternatively be fixed to an axle (64), Fig. 7 (not shown) which is mounted with play and the displacement of the wheel may be limited by stops in the form of sleeve walls (71, 72), Fig. 8 (not shown).
